Pysanky for Peace.
Everyday from Mar 4, 2024 - Mar 31, 2024 at 12:00 am - 12:00 am
Pysanky for Peace is a Ukrainian artwork fundraiser intended to raise funds and support for Ukrainians who have been displaced or otherwise impacted by the war in Ukraine. A group of more than 20 local artists led by pysanka master Daena Diduck, will design 50 three dimensional eggs (in honour of Southcentre’s 50th anniversary this year), ranging from a few inches to nearly five feet tall. The eggs will be displayed at the mall as public art until the end of the month and will be available for purchase in exchange for a donation to WUNDERfund, a nonprofit that provides humanitarian aid to Ukrainians locally and abroad.

Indigenous History Month Celebration at Southcentre Mall.
Everyday from Jan 1, 1970 - Jun 23, 2024 at 12:00 am - 8:00 pm
Join us at Southcentre Mall from June 3rd to 23rd for our fourth annual Indigenous History Month celebration in partnership with Authentically Indigenous. This month-long event will foster understanding, appreciation, and celebration of Canada’s Indigenous Peoples. Experience educational activities, cultural displays, and storytelling sessions that connect both Indigenous and non-Indigenous Canadians. The celebrations will include: Full-Size Tipi: Step inside a tipi adorned with tapestries representing decades of Indigenous contributions to Calgary’s culture. Storytelling: Be moved by traditional stories from elders, delight in puppet shows by Indigenous authors, and explore virtual reality experiences by the Urban Society for Aboriginal Youth. Artisan Market: Discover the vibrancy of Indigenous creativity at our artisan market on June 7th and 8th. Enjoy music, dance, and locally crafted goods. Educational Information Walls: Learn and engage with displays that provide deeper insights into Indigenous culture.
